First, beginning with summer courses, we will use remote proctoring services to administer exams to protect exam integrity with ATI and Examplify (ExamSoft). Proctorio is the service we will use for all ATI exams, ExamID and Exam Monitor will be used to administer exams with Examplify (ExamSoft). The first attached document is a Student Quick start guide that outlines the technical requirements to use Proctorio. The second document describes the technical requirements and student preparation before and after completing your exam in Examplify and the last document is the agreement to collect biometric data when taking an exam in Examplify. Both proctoring services require a webcam and microphone. Please read all three documents carefully.
Please contact your respective summer course faculty if you do not have these technical features on your laptop or desktop computer. We plan to begin using these proctoring features in the NURS 4414 and NURS 4301 then continue in NURS 4424 and NRS 4434.
As a reminder to Professor Remibish's announcement/email on 4/22, you will be taking one dosage calculation test for the summer at the beginning of your Behavioral Health course. This test will include calculations similar to what you have done in fundamentals, but will also include drop rates for IV therapy (gtt/min) and pediatric weight based questions. The pediatric weight based questions are different than what you have done thus far as they often refer to safe dosing parameters. While not mandatory, we STRONGLY suggest using all of the resources listed below to prepare:
1. Complete the ATI tutorial pediatric modules (these can be found under the dosage calculation module section you have been working in) You DO NOT need to upload results to Husky CT
2. Complete the ATI practice assessment which is open and available
3. Go to Husky CT under "Organizations" and then into "CEIN BS Information" then to the "Dosage Calculation" tab. There you will find a PPT to review, multiple videos on pediatric calculations, a word document to help you organize pediatric dosage calc questions and 2 practice tests.
4. Review the Policy which is also listed under the dosage calculation tab.
